Financial Code - FIN

DIVISION 6. ESCROW AGENTS [17000 - 17703]

  ( Division 6 enacted by Stats. 1951, Ch. 364. )

CHAPTER 2.5. Escrow Agents’ Fidelity Corporation [17300 - 17350]

  ( Heading of Chapter 2.5 amended by Stats. 1988, Ch. 1458, Sec. 1. )
ARTICLE 1. Definitions [17300 - 17305]
  ( Article 1 added by Stats. 1982, Ch. 1106, Sec. 1. )

17300.  

“Fidelity Corporation” means the Escrow Agents’ Fidelity Corporation.

(Amended by Stats. 1985, Ch. 1560, Sec. 6. Effective October 2, 1985.)

17301.  

“Member” means any person licensed under this division who is required by Section 17312 to be a member of Fidelity Corporation.

(Amended by Stats. 1985, Ch. 1560, Sec. 7. Effective October 2, 1985.)

17302.  

“Trust obligation” means:

(a) All money and property deposited with a member within the State of California in an escrow or joint control transaction.

(b) All money and property deposited with a member to be held in trust within the State of California pursuant to a federal or state statute or requirements of a governmental agency.

(Amended by Stats. 2001, Ch. 662, Sec. 1. Effective January 1, 2002.)

17303.  

“Commissioner” means the Commissioner of Corporations.

(Added by Stats. 1982, Ch. 1106, Sec. 1.)

17304.  

“Loss,” within the meaning of this chapter, means the loss of trust obligations held by a member within the State of California as a result of the fraudulent or dishonest abstraction, misappropriation, or embezzlement of trust obligations by an officer, director, trustee, stockholder, manager, or employee of a member.

(Amended by Stats. 2001, Ch. 662, Sec. 2. Effective January 1, 2002.)

17305.  

“Monthly average escrow liability,” as used in this chapter, means the average escrow liability for the 12-month period as reported in the most recent report made by the member to the commissioner pursuant to Section 17348.

(Amended by Stats. 1989, Ch. 590, Sec. 1.)
